Finance Review Summary — Brindlecore Plus Tier

To heads of department: the new Brindlecore Plus subscription tier launched on schedule. Uptake at 6% of active base, above forecast. ARPU up 11%; churn flat. Support costs slightly elevated due to onboarding queries. Margin impact positive from month two. Pricing holds through Q3; no discounting authorised. Full model refresh due next cycle. Direction for the tier's expansion is set out in the note below.

internal memo for yaduf-fahap: The board signed off on a budget of $4.5 million for Project Ralix. The renewal with Eliokox Freight closes at $63.8 million a year, 9 percent below the last contract.

// Config hot-reloading for the Brindlemere client.
// The watcher polls /etc/brindlemere/client.toml every 15s and applies
// changes without a restart. Connection pool size, retry budgets, and
// timeout values are all reloadable; endpoint URLs are not, by design,
// since swapping hosts mid-flight corrupted the session cache in the
// 3.2 release. Reload events are logged at INFO so the release manager
// can confirm rollout without shelling in. The client authenticates to
// the internal Fennic registry with the key that follows.

app token of tageg-kadug = vxb2-26

**Alert: BranchSweep scheduled deletion — plugin repositories**

BranchSweep has flagged branches in your plugin repository as stale (no commits in 90 days). Flagged branches will be archived as tags and deleted in 14 days. To exempt a branch, add it to the sweep-ignore file in your repo root. Archived branches can be restored within 60 days. Questions about exemptions or restores can be sent here.

escalation mailbox, bafog-fafog: ulador@paliqlabs.internal

**Ticket: Config drift on TideTrack widget (coastal pages)**

The tide-table widget on Harborwyn's coastal pages is showing stale intervals in prod but not staging. Deploy history suggests someone hand-edited the prod config during the Gullport incident and never backported it. Compare against staging before reverting. Current prod values are as follows.

settings of tagef-bawif:
DRUIX_HOST=druix.zemvarlabs.internal
DRUIX_PORT=8000